记录Linux(文件,网络,压缩,链接命令)

记录Linux(文件,网络,压缩,链接命令) 一、目录操作pwd查看当前所在路径ls列出目录内容ls -l详细信息ls -a显示隐藏文件cd切换目录cd ..返回上一级cd /回到根目录cd ~回到家目录mkdir 文件夹名创建文件夹rmdir 文件夹名删除空文件夹find 查找目录apt update 在线更新软件源man命令 1对应命令 2对应系统调用 3对应库函数二、文件操作touch 文件名创建空文件 文本文件sudo su 进入ROOTmkdir 创建文件夹echo 打印输出文字sudo useradd -m 创建用户组sudo passow 设置密码sudo usermod -g 添加用户到组sudo groupadd 创建用户组sudo chmod urwx,go--- 主目录设置为自身可读可写可执行rm 文件名删除文件rm -r 目录递归删除文件夹rm -f强制删除cp 源文件 目标复制文件 / 文件夹mv 源 目标移动文件 / 重命名三、网络命令ping测试网络连通 常见命令 ping 目标地址ifconfig 查看及临时配置网络接口参数 IP 子网掩码 macipconfig 查看Windows网络接口的配置信息 IP 子网掩码 网关ip 多功能网络管理工具 查看所有接口ip地址 常见命名ip addr shownmcli connection show 列出当前系统中所有网络链接配置信息包括接口类型关联设备等sudo nmcli connection modify 以管理员权限修改指定网络连接的配置可设置ip地址网关 dns等参数静态使用格式sudo nmcli connection modify “连接名称” ipv4.addresses ip地址 子网掩码 ipv4.gateway 网关地址 ipv4.dns dnf服务器地址 ipv4.method manual动态使用格式sudo nmcli connection modify “连接名称” ipv4method autosudo nmcli connection up 以管理员权限重启指定的网络连接使修改后的网络配置生效四、压缩解压tar最常用打包解压压缩tar -zcvf 包名.tar.gz 目录解压tar -zxvf 包名.tar.gzZ 代表 启用 gzip 压缩 / 解压 调用 gzip 算法处理压缩包自动识别.gz后缀C 代表创建一个文件的归档X 代表 提取 把包中文件提取出来V 详细模式 实时显示正在处理的文件名和进度F 指定文件 明确指定要操作的归档文件名zip/unzipzip 格式压缩解压五、链接1.Ln 硬链接硬链接格式Ln 被链接的文件 创建硬链接文件名称典型用途 数据备份多个硬链接共享数据避免误删丢失数据文件多入口访问同一文件多个名称共享数据。2.Ln-s软链接软链接格式Ln-s 被链接的文件/目录 创建软链接文件名称典型用途 快捷方式简化长路径访问动态路径切换通过修改软链接指向不同版本或路径跨文件链接挂载设备的文件链接到本地目录。